Cirque Peak

Category : Peak
 

The descriptive name for this mountain peak, 2993 m in altitude, was approved in 1909. The semi-circular formation of limestone on the peak gives the impression of a huge amphitheatre.

Approximately 85 km north-west of Banff.

Location Name : Hector Lake
Elevation Height : 2,993 m.
National Topographic System (NTS) : 82 N/9
